


What to do if the SQL installation program is initialized error? SQL installation error handling
May 28, 2025 pm 07:45 PMThe SQL installer initialization error can be solved through the following steps: 1) View the installation log and look for error information; 2) Check whether the system meets the SQL Server requirements; 3) Solve permission issues and ensure that they run as an administrator; 4) Handle dependencies and prerequisites, such as .NET Framework; 5) Adjust network and firewall configurations. Through these steps, you can successfully resolve SQL installer initialization errors.
When dealing with SQL installer initialization errors, you need to stay calm first, as these errors can usually be resolved with some systematic steps. I have encountered similar installation problems and finally solved it successfully by troubleshooting logs and adjusting configurations. The following are my experience sharing and detailed steps, I hope it can help you solve the problem smoothly.
Handle SQL installer initialization error
When you encounter SQL installer initialization error, the first thing you need to do is to view the installation log. These log files usually record the details of the error and help you locate the problem. I remember one time when I installed SQL Server, the initialization error was because my system did not have enough disk space. After checking the logs, I cleaned up the hard drive and reinstalled successfully.
Check system requirements
It is very critical to make sure your system meets the minimum requirements of SQL Server. I remember one time, I tried to install a new version of SQL Server on an old server, but it failed because the processor did not support certain instruction sets. By consulting the official documentation, I learned that I need to upgrade the hardware or choose a compatible version.
Solve permission issues
Permission issues are also a common source of errors. I once tried to install on an account without administrator privileges and it failed. After solving this problem, the installation proceeded smoothly. This reminds us how important it is to ensure that the installer is run as an administrator.
Handle dependencies and prerequisites
SQL Server installations may depend on other software or components, such as the .NET Framework. If these dependencies are not installed correctly or the version does not match, an initialization error occurs. I remember one time the installation failed because the .NET Framework version mismatched. After updating to the correct version, the problem was solved.
Network and firewall configuration
Sometimes, network problems or firewall settings can also cause initialization errors. I used to install SQL Server in a network environment with strict firewall rules and failed because I couldn't access some online resources. After adjusting the firewall settings, the installation proceeds successfully.
Code example: Check the installation log
If you want to write a simple script to check for errors in the installation log, you can refer to the following Python code:
import re def check_install_log(log_file_path): with open(log_file_path, 'r') as file: log_content = file.read() # Find common error messages errors = re.findall(r'Error:\s*(.*?)\n', log_content) If errors: print("The following is the error found in the installation log:") for error in errors: print(error) else: print("No error message was found in the installation log.") # Use example check_install_log('path/to/your/installation_log.txt')
This script will read the installation log file, find and output any line containing "Error:", helping you quickly locate the problem.
Think deeply and suggest
There are several points to consider when dealing with SQL installation errors:
- Depth of log analysis : The log file may contain a lot of information, and the key is to find the parts related to the error. Using regular expressions or other text processing tools can improve efficiency.
- Complexity of the system environment : Sometimes the cause of errors may be related to your system configuration, and it is necessary to carefully check the system settings and environment variables.
- Version Compatibility : Ensure that all components are compatible, this is especially important in multi-version environments.
- Backup and Recovery Plan : It is wise to back up your existing database and configuration before attempting to install, just in case the installation fails to cause data loss.
Through these steps and thoughts, I hope you can successfully resolve SQL installer initialization errors. If you have more problems or encounter other types of errors, please continue to discuss them. I am happy to share more experiences and solutions.
The above is the detailed content of What to do if the SQL installation program is initialized error? SQL installation error handling. For more information, please follow other related articles on the PHP Chinese website!

Hot AI Tools

Undress AI Tool
Undress images for free

Undresser.AI Undress
AI-powered app for creating realistic nude photos

AI Clothes Remover
Online AI tool for removing clothes from photos.

Clothoff.io
AI clothes remover

Video Face Swap
Swap faces in any video effortlessly with our completely free AI face swap tool!

Hot Article

Hot Tools

Notepad++7.3.1
Easy-to-use and free code editor

SublimeText3 Chinese version
Chinese version, very easy to use

Zend Studio 13.0.1
Powerful PHP integrated development environment

Dreamweaver CS6
Visual web development tools

SublimeText3 Mac version
God-level code editing software (SublimeText3)

Hot Topics

Currency circle contract trading is a derivative trading method that uses a small amount of funds to control assets with larger value. It allows traders to speculate on the price trends of crypto assets without actually owning them. Entering the contract market requires understanding its basic operations and related concepts.

When choosing a suitable formal Bitcoin trading platform, you should consider comprehensively from the dimensions of compliance, transaction depth, and functional support. The above ten platforms are widely recognized among global users and provide safe and direct official websites. It is recommended that users give priority to accessing and registering through the official website to avoid third-party links and ensure the security of account assets. In the future, the functions of trading platforms will be more intelligent, and it is recommended to continue to pay attention to the updates and activity policies of each platform.

The Virtual Digital Coin Exchange APP is a powerful digital asset trading tool, committed to providing safe, professional and convenient trading services to global users. The platform supports a variety of mainstream and emerging digital asset transactions, with a bank-level security protection system and a smooth operating experience.

As an investment method, the currency circle contract order has attracted many investors who want to participate in cryptocurrency contract trading but do not have sufficient time and expertise. The basic principle is to associate your trading account with the outstanding trader's account selected on the platform, and the system will automatically synchronize the trader's opening and closing operation. The user does not need to manually analyze the market and execute the transaction, and the follower is done by the trader. This model seems to simplify the trading process, but it is accompanied by a series of issues that require careful consideration.

How do novice users choose a safe and reliable stablecoin platform? This article recommends the Top 10 stablecoin platforms in 2025, including Binance, OKX, Bybit, Gate.io, HTX, KuCoin, MEXC, Bitget, CoinEx and ProBit, and compares and analyzes them from dimensions such as security, stablecoin types, liquidity, user experience, fee structure and additional functions. The data comes from CoinGecko, DefiLlama and community evaluation. It is recommended that novices choose platforms that are highly compliant, easy to operate and support Chinese, such as KuCoin and CoinEx, and gradually build confidence through a small number of tests.

Bitcoin contract trading attracts numerous participants, which provides opportunities to leverage for potentially high returns. However, the inherent risk of contract trading lies in forced closing of positions, commonly known as "losing of positions". A liquidation means that the trader's position is forced to close due to the loss of margin, which often loses most or even all of the initial margin. Understanding how to set up a liquidation warning and mastering skills to avoid forced liquidation is crucial to managing contract trading risks.

Bitcoin is neither a pure scam nor a single future trend, but an innovative asset that combines controversy and value. Its core value is reflected in: 1. Anti-inflation characteristics, fixed total volume makes it scarce and is regarded as digital gold; 2. Global liquidity, supporting low-cost cross-border transactions; 3. Decentralization and censorship resistance, ensuring user asset autonomy; 4. Technological innovation, underlying blockchain promotes the transformation of trust mechanisms and data storage. Despite the challenges of regulatory and volatility, Bitcoin continues to have far-reaching impacts in the financial and technology fields.

When you encounter the "DefaultGatewayisNotAvailable" prompt, it means that the computer cannot connect to the router or does not obtain the network address correctly. 1. First, restart the router and computer, wait for the router to fully start before trying to connect; 2. Check whether the IP address is set to automatically obtain, enter the network attribute to ensure that "Automatically obtain IP address" and "Automatically obtain DNS server address" are selected; 3. Run ipconfig/release and ipconfig/renew through the command prompt to release and re-acquire the IP address, and execute the netsh command to reset the network components if necessary; 4. Check the wireless network card driver, update or reinstall the driver to ensure that it works normally.
